Bug#953057: subversion: FTBFS against swig 4

2020-03-05 Thread James McCoy
Control: merge 951893 -1

On Tue, Mar 03, 2020 at 06:20:54PM -0300, Lucas Kanashiro wrote:
> While trying to rebuild src:subversion in a clean unstable amd64 chroot
> I got the following error:
> 
> ...
> Wrote subversion/bindings/swig/proxy/swig_python_external_runtime.swg
> /usr/bin/swig -I/<>/BUILD/subversion
> -I/<>/subversion/include
> -I/<>/subversion/bindings/swig
> -I/<>/subversion/bindings/swig/include
> -I/<>/subversion/bindings/swig/proxy
> -I/<>/BUILD/subversion/bindings/swig/proxy
> -I/usr/include/apr-1.0  -I/usr/include/apr-1.0 -I/usr/include  -python 
> -classic -o subversion/bindings/swig/python/core.c
> /<>/subversion/bindings/swig/core.i
> Deprecated command line option: -classic. This option is no longer
> supported.
> make[1]: *** [/<>/build-outputs.mk:290:
> subversion/bindings/swig/python/core.c] Error 1
> make[1]: Leaving directory '/<>/BUILD'
> make: *** [debian/rules:228: debian/stamp-build-arch] Error 2
> dpkg-buildpackage: error: debian/rules binary subprocess returned exit
> status 2
> 
> This is a known open upstream bug [1]. Just dropping the '-classic'
> option does not work, other errors pop up.

Yeah, already discussed in #951893.

Cheers,
-- 
James
GPG Key: 4096R/91BF BF4D 6956 BD5D F7B7  2D23 DFE6 91AE 331B A3DB



Bug#953057: subversion: FTBFS against swig 4

2020-03-03 Thread Lucas Kanashiro
Source: subversion
Version: 1.13.0-2
Severity: important

Dear Maintainer,

While trying to rebuild src:subversion in a clean unstable amd64 chroot
I got the following error:

...
Wrote subversion/bindings/swig/proxy/swig_python_external_runtime.swg
/usr/bin/swig -I/<>/BUILD/subversion
-I/<>/subversion/include
-I/<>/subversion/bindings/swig
-I/<>/subversion/bindings/swig/include
-I/<>/subversion/bindings/swig/proxy
-I/<>/BUILD/subversion/bindings/swig/proxy
-I/usr/include/apr-1.0  -I/usr/include/apr-1.0 -I/usr/include  -python 
-classic -o subversion/bindings/swig/python/core.c
/<>/subversion/bindings/swig/core.i
Deprecated command line option: -classic. This option is no longer
supported.
make[1]: *** [/<>/build-outputs.mk:290:
subversion/bindings/swig/python/core.c] Error 1
make[1]: Leaving directory '/<>/BUILD'
make: *** [debian/rules:228: debian/stamp-build-arch] Error 2
dpkg-buildpackage: error: debian/rules binary subprocess returned exit
status 2

This is a known open upstream bug [1]. Just dropping the '-classic'
option does not work, other errors pop up.

[1] https://issues.apache.org/jira/browse/SVN-4818

-- 
Lucas Kanashiro